Over 300 volunteers will be hitting the streets of Red Deer tonight, to talk to people experiencing homelessness.

The Point in Time homeless count will go from 9 to 11 tonight, as Red Deerians try to get some more detailed information on the homeless, like demographic, and key issues they’re facing.

Roxana Stewart with the City says the count is all part of their 5 year plan to end homelessness.

“We analyze the numbers and we see if there’s any particular demographics within the numbers that perhaps aren’t being served appropriately or efficiently or in the best way. Then we can make changes to fix those problems.”

Roxana Stewart says numbers may be different this year as they conduct their third count, but need to be looked at in the bigger picture of things.

“We need to remember that this is just a snapshot of just the one night. But it’s important not to just look at the numbers standing alone by themselves, but to consider the context of the community and the economic conditions we’re facing.”

Stewart says along with the 300 people, 25 organizations have stepped forward to offer their help.
